SECTION-A
- Answer briefly :
- Explain the term 'Total Internal Reflection'.
- Write two necessary conditions for interference.
- Two equal forces act at a point. The square of their resultant is 3 times their product. Find the angle between them.
- How does the ball bearings reduce friction?
- A truck and car are moving with the same kinetic energy on a straight road. Their engines are simultaneously switched off. Which one will stop at a lesser distance?
- Explain why waves on strings are always transverse?
- The soldiers marching on a suspended bridge are advised to go out of steps. Why?
- Transverse waves are not produced in liquids and gases. Why?
- The speed of sound waves depends on temperature but speed of light waves does not. Why?
- What forces keep the simple pendulum in simple harmonic motion?

SECTION-B
- Find an expression for fringe width in case of Young’s double slit experiment. Prove that in this case of interference dark and bright bands are of equal width.
- What is a uniform circular motion? Explain the terms; time period; frequency and angular velocity. Establish relation them.
-
- Calculate the amount of work done in moving a body up a rough inclined plane.
- A machine gun has a mass of 10 kg. It fires 30 gram bullets at the rate of 6 bullets per second with a speed of 400 m/s. What force must be applied to the gun to keep it in a position?
-
- What are conservative and non-conservative forces, explain with examples?
- What is meant by positive work, negative work and zero work? Illustrate your answer with examples.

SECTION-C
- Find the total energy of the particle executing simple harmonic motion and show graphically the variation of potential energy and kinetic energy with time in simple harmonic motion.
- Give analytical treatment of formation of standing waves on strings and discuss briefly the normal modes of vibration of strings.
- Explain Doppler Effect in sound. Obtain an expression for apparent frequency of sound when source and listener are approaching each other.
- Discuss analytically how standing waves are formed in closed organ pipes. Also discuss normal modes of vibration of the pipes.
